daThe Aloha! Boom Boom! is a Primary weapon introduced in the 16.5.0 update. It is unlocked by obtaining 250 Mythical from the Summer Adventure Event Chest in that update.
Description
It is a Hawaiian-themed machine gun that automatically shoots regular bullets that slow down the opponents. It has very good damage, a decent fire rate , a good capacity, and slow mobility. It is 6-7 shots at normal condition and with a high level module, it only take 3-4 shots to kill an enemy in the head.
Appearance
It appears to be a colorful submachine gun with grass-like stocks, a handgrip, a handguard, a cylindrical magazine, and a scope. Every grass-like aspect mentioned has flower-like sproutings. When firing, it appears that little pink flowers similar to the ones on the gun appear briefly out of the gun. This may be a special effect, like the Manga Gun.
Performance
This weapon automatically shoots regular bullets with instant bullet travel time. These bullets can slow down the target, temporarily reducing their mobility. Moreover, this weapon possesses a 4x zoom optic sight to allow longer range fighting.
When reloading, the drum magazine is taken out and is replaced by another one. It has fixed delay meaning there will always be a small delay whenever the player switches to this weapon.
Strategy
Tips
- Use this in medium to long ranges as the scope isn’t that strong.
- Aim for the head to deal more damage.
- Use the slowdown to your advantage.
- Example: A weakened enemy that is trying to escape, or a person trying to escape with your flag in Flag Capture mode will move slowly and therefore be vulnerable to upcoming attacks.
- Use the scope for long-range engagements.
- Switch to any 80 or 85 mobility weapon as the mobility is quite low.
- Reload frequently and undercover as the capacity isn’t that large.
Counters
- Attack the user from a long-range. But strafe around as the slowdown is strong.
- Flank the user with a high damaging weapon.
- Strafe to waste the user's ammo, but be aware of the slow-down abilities.
- Use the Reflector (Gadget) to inflict damage on the user too.
- Use a one-shot sniper, such as the Anti-Champion Rifle or the One Shot.
- If you are hit, use rocket jump to escape the place.
- If all else fails, use this yourself.

Trivia
- It is based on the M1921 Thompson Submachine Gun.
- It is one of three guns with onomatopoeic names, the others being the Ka-Boom! (PG3D) and the Pew Pew Rifle.
